Clothes on the radiator are dried in this way to avoid creating humidity
Before explaining how to dry clothes on the radiator without creating humidity, let’s take a quick look at the rules to follow during washing.
Increase the rotation speed to remove as much water as possible.
Don’t use too much detergent, it will settle between the fibers and slow down the drying process, absorbing bad odors due to condensation.
